關於button的MOUSEMOVE訊息的新增

2021-05-28 11:44:28 字數 374 閱讀 7506

本人小白,剛剛開始mfc。

如果要給button空間加wm_mousemove訊息。在vs2008上,在按鈕上單擊滑鼠右鍵新增訊息處理函式,這個方法失敗,原因是沒有wm_mousemove這個訊息。

解決方法

1.新建乙個繼承cbutton類的新類叫做cxx。

2.將對話方塊的按鈕新增控制項變數m_butn,在類選擇裡用cxx。

3.在cxx類裡加乙個成員cxx* pbtn,在oninitial()裡將m_butn關聯在pbtn裡。

4.在給cxx新增wm_mousemove訊息處理函式使用pbtn操作按鈕。 反思

對於cbutton來說好使,那對於其他控制項是否好使? 實驗

同樣按照上述步驟對cedit控制項操作,成功。

關於Button的錯誤使用

今天犯了乙個很低階的錯誤,將乙個按鈕的點選事件監聽,放置與另乙個按鈕的點選時間中.錯誤的導致原因是 混亂 findviewbyid r.id.btn1 setonclicklistener new view.onclicklistener override public void onclick v...

關於button與submit的區別

最近我在表單中使用了button標籤,我的本意並不是想要提交表單,但是很奇怪,我明明只是用了button,並沒有建立submit啊,查閱資料之後,原來是這樣的,這是w3school裡的原話 如果在 html 表單中使用 button 元素,不同的瀏覽器會提交不同的值。internet explore...

Button的基本使用

button按鈕 常用關鍵字實參 text fg bg command width height 注意 建立完元件後要呼叫pack 方法,才能顯示元件 畫布canvas 例項化畫布 c canvas tk物件,其他屬性 canvas也要呼叫pack 畫線 create line 四個引數代表線條座標...